11: root {
22 font-family : Inter, -apple-system, BlinkMacSystemFont, 'Segoe UI' , sans-serif;
3- color : # e5e7eb ;
4- background : # 070b18 ;
3+ color : # f3e8ff ;
4+ background : # 12061f ;
55}
66
77* { box-sizing : border-box; }
1010 margin : 0 ;
1111 min-height : 100vh ;
1212 background :
13- radial-gradient (circle at 20 % 0% , rgba (59 , 130 , 246 , 0.35 ), transparent 40 % ),
14- radial-gradient (circle at 80 % 0% , rgba (168 , 85 , 247 , 0.25 ), transparent 35 % ),
15- # 070b18 ;
13+ radial-gradient (circle at 18 % 0% , rgba (192 , 132 , 252 , 0.45 ), transparent 42 % ),
14+ radial-gradient (circle at 82 % 0% , rgba (139 , 92 , 246 , 0.30 ), transparent 36 % ),
15+ # 12061f ;
1616}
1717
1818.app-shell {
4141}
4242
4343.badge {
44- background : linear-gradient (135deg , # 22d3ee , # 818cf8 );
45- color : # 0f172a ;
44+ background : linear-gradient (135deg , # c084fc , # 8b5cf6 );
45+ color : # 2a0e42 ;
4646 font-weight : 700 ;
4747 font-size : 12px ;
4848 padding : 8px 12px ;
5353 margin-bottom : 14px ;
5454 padding : 10px 12px ;
5555 border-radius : 10px ;
56- background : rgba (16 , 185 , 129 , 0.15 );
57- border : 1px solid rgba (16 , 185 , 129 , 0.4 );
58- color : # 6ee7b7 ;
56+ background : rgba (168 , 85 , 247 , 0.18 );
57+ border : 1px solid rgba (196 , 181 , 253 , 0.45 );
58+ color : # e9d5ff ;
5959}
6060
6161.main-grid {
@@ -66,11 +66,11 @@ body {
6666}
6767
6868.panel {
69- background : linear-gradient (180deg , rgba (15 , 23 , 42 , 0.96 ), rgba (9 , 15 , 30 , 0.95 ));
70- border : 1px solid rgba (148 , 163 , 184 , 0.2 );
69+ background : linear-gradient (180deg , rgba (40 , 18 , 70 , 0.94 ), rgba (28 , 12 , 52 , 0.96 ));
70+ border : 1px solid rgba (192 , 132 , 252 , 0.28 );
7171 border-radius : 16px ;
7272 padding : 14px ;
73- box-shadow : 0 20px 35px rgba (0 , 0 , 0 , 0.35 );
73+ box-shadow : 0 20px 35px rgba (12 , 2 , 24 , 0.45 );
7474}
7575
7676.panel h2 {
@@ -92,9 +92,9 @@ input, textarea, select, button {
9292
9393input , textarea , select {
9494 margin-top : 6px ;
95- border : 1px solid rgba (148 , 163 , 184 , 0.35 );
96- background : rgba (15 , 23 , 42 , 0.75 );
97- color : # e2e8f0 ;
95+ border : 1px solid rgba (196 , 181 , 253 , 0.35 );
96+ background : rgba (46 , 16 , 81 , 0.6 );
97+ color : # f3e8ff ;
9898 border-radius : 10px ;
9999 padding : 10px ;
100100}
@@ -109,8 +109,8 @@ textarea { min-height: 84px; resize: vertical; }
109109
110110.primary-btn , button {
111111 border : none;
112- background : linear-gradient (135deg , # 3b82f6 , # 8b5cf6 );
113- color : white ;
112+ background : linear-gradient (135deg , # a855f7 , # 7c3aed );
113+ color : # faf5ff ;
114114 border-radius : 10px ;
115115 padding : 10px 12px ;
116116 font-weight : 600 ;
@@ -126,7 +126,7 @@ button:disabled { opacity: 0.5; cursor: not-allowed; }
126126}
127127
128128.hint {
129- color : # 93c5fd ;
129+ color : # d8b4fe ;
130130 font-size : 12px ;
131131 margin-top : 10px ;
132132}
@@ -163,8 +163,8 @@ button:disabled { opacity: 0.5; cursor: not-allowed; }
163163}
164164
165165.slide-card {
166- background : rgba (2 , 6 , 23 , 0.65 );
167- border : 1px solid rgba (148 , 163 , 184 , 0.2 );
166+ background : rgba (30 , 10 , 54 , 0.68 );
167+ border : 1px solid rgba (192 , 132 , 252 , 0.25 );
168168 border-radius : 12px ;
169169 padding : 10px ;
170170 margin-bottom : 10px ;
@@ -175,25 +175,25 @@ button:disabled { opacity: 0.5; cursor: not-allowed; }
175175.slide-card span {
176176 display : inline-block;
177177 font-size : 12px ;
178- color : # 93c5fd ;
178+ color : # c4b5fd ;
179179 margin-bottom : 2px ;
180180}
181181
182182.skeleton {
183183 border-radius : 10px ;
184184 padding : 14px ;
185- background : rgba (148 , 163 , 184 , 0.08 );
186- border : 1px dashed rgba (148 , 163 , 184 , 0.4 );
187- color : # 94a3b8 ;
185+ background : rgba (168 , 85 , 247 , 0.10 );
186+ border : 1px dashed rgba (196 , 181 , 253 , 0.45 );
187+ color : # d8b4fe ;
188188}
189189
190190.chat-box {
191191 height : 62vh ;
192192 overflow : auto;
193193 border-radius : 12px ;
194194 padding : 10px ;
195- background : rgba (2 , 6 , 23 , 0.7 );
196- border : 1px solid rgba (148 , 163 , 184 , 0.18 );
195+ background : rgba (24 , 8 , 44 , 0.74 );
196+ border : 1px solid rgba (196 , 181 , 253 , 0.22 );
197197 margin-bottom : 10px ;
198198}
199199
@@ -207,13 +207,13 @@ button:disabled { opacity: 0.5; cursor: not-allowed; }
207207}
208208
209209.msg .user {
210- background : rgba (59 , 130 , 246 , 0.25 );
211- border : 1px solid rgba (59 , 130 , 246 , 0.4 );
210+ background : rgba (168 , 85 , 247 , 0.30 );
211+ border : 1px solid rgba (192 , 132 , 252 , 0.45 );
212212}
213213
214214.msg .assistant {
215- background : rgba (30 , 41 , 59 , 0.9 );
216- border : 1px solid rgba (148 , 163 , 184 , 0.25 );
215+ background : rgba (44 , 16 , 74 , 0.85 );
216+ border : 1px solid rgba (196 , 181 , 253 , 0.26 );
217217}
218218
219219.chat-input-row {
0 commit comments